What Are Reproductive Rights?

Reproductive rights involve your independence to decide how, when, and whether to have children. Reproductive rights for women are in a state of flux as some states are limiting or banning abortion and other types of reproductive care. Reproductive rights include decisions about:

  • Family planning
  • Abortion
  • Birth control and contraception
  • Assisted reproductive technology (ART)
  • Sterilization
  • Sex education

What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need a Reproductive Rights Lawyer?

You may need a reproductive rights lawyer if you have trouble accessing reproductive care in any form. There are different challenges for people to help with family planning and birth control. You may not be able to get reproductive care because of cost, parental control, or state laws. A reproductive rights lawyer can help you get the reproductive care you need.

How Can a Reproductive Rights Lawyer Help Me?

A reproductive rights attorney will be an advocate to act in your best interests. A reproductive rights lawyer can identify your legal options and help you decide the best way to get the care you need. Your attorney can also represent you in court if your parents, partner, or the state wants to limit your access to reproductive care.

What Could Happen if I Don’t Hire a Reproductive Rights Lawyer?

Without a lawyer, you may lose your independent control over your reproductive rights. The court system can be confusing, and it will be difficult to gather the evidence and make the right arguments without a lawyer’s help. Before you take such a big step, make sure you understand your legal rights and options for reproductive care.
